Fabulous location and exceptional opportunity in Bronte! Situated on a rare 50 x 199 ft level lot in one of Oakville's most sought-after neighborhoods, this home offers immediate enjoyment while you plan and build your dream home. Kitchen and bathroom updated in 2025. The city has already approved plans for a stunning 3,850 sq. ft. custom luxury residence, saving valuable time and effort in the building process. The spacious lot providing maximum flexibility for future construction, while the existing inground saltwater pool is positioned at the rear of the property for summer enjoyment. Ideally located within walking distance to downtown Bronte, the lake, two harbours, marinas, schools, parks, groceries, shopping, churches, and public transit, this quiet street is surrounded by many custom-built homes, making it a premier destination for builders and end users alike. Whether you're looking to enjoy the current home, invest, or create your custom dream residence, this is a rare opportunity to secure a premium lot in an established lakeside community.
